DFileSystemImageEvents::Update 方法 (imapi2fs.h)

实现此方法可接收当前写入操作的进度通知。 复制文件内容或将目录或文件添加到文件系统映像时发送通知。

语法

HRESULT Update(
  [in]  IDispatch *object,
  [in]  BSTR      currentFile,
  [in]  LONG      copiedSectors,
  [out] LONG      totalSectors
);

parameters

[in] object

正在写入的文件系统映像的 IFileSystemImage 接口。

此参数是脚本中的 CFileSystemImage 对象。

[in] currentFile

包含所写入文件的完整路径的字符串。

[in] copiedSectors

复制的扇区数。

[out] totalSectors

文件中的扇区总数。

返回值

忽略返回值。

注解

发送通知以响应调用以下方法之一:

调用以下方法之一导入使用即时分配 (即时分配创建的 UDF 文件系统时,还可以发送通知,这意味着文件数据包含在文件描述符中,而不是在文件描述符中包含指向数据) 扇区的分配描述符: 发送通知:
  • 在添加文件的第一个扇区之前, (copiedSectors 为 0)
  • 对于写入的每个兆字节
  • 在最终写入后一次,如果文件未在兆字节边界上结束

要求

   
最低受支持的客户端 Windows Vista、Windows XP 和 SP2 [仅限桌面应用]
最低受支持的服务器 Windows Server 2003 [仅限桌面应用]
目标平台 Windows
标头 imapi2fs.h

另请参阅

DFileSystemImageEvents